Euonymus alatus tree seeds, known variously as winged spindle bush seeds, winged euonymus seeds, or burning bush seeds, is a species of flowering plant in the family Celastraceae, native to central and northern China, Japan, and Korea. Burning bush grows from seeds, but it is much slower than taking cuttings. Collect the seeds in autumn and place them in a jar of sand. Refrigerate them at about 40 degrees F. (4 C.) for at least three months to encourage them to break dormancy. Plant the seeds in summer when the soil is warm. It takes them about eight weeks to germinate. Burning bush self-seeds so readily that you are likely to lament the fact that it grows from seeds at all.
